There are also a heap of US champs athletes who have WAY lower mileages than you might imagine. Especially If you are working full time, have kids, other commitments, etc then the mileage has to be a secondary priority in order to keep your workouts hard. If you are looking to get faster then:
1) Increase intensity of workouts while keeping mileage the same
2) Increase distance of some workouts while giving a little in speed
3) Only then increase base mileage
